    Walkthrough

    The pull request involves two primary changes: the removal of a GitHub Actions workflow file for PR automation and updates to the README.md file. The workflow file .github/workflows/pr_agent.yml was deleted, which previously managed automated interactions for pull requests. The README.md was modified to update badge links, specifically replacing the OpenUPM badge with a new version, adding a CodeFactor badge, and introducing an introduction section about VR Builder's capabilities.
